My mother came here on visitors visa (Single entry) in April 2003 and she got one extension for visitors visa valid till end of March 2004. We applied for immigration of both my parents recently and as we see from the website of CIC.GC.CA, currently they are taking about 8 months to clear the sponsorship applications in Canada. As i understand from postings on this website, it is likely to take 2 to 3 years to get imiigration visa for my parents from Delhi. My mother is willing to stay here with us as long as possible and my father wants to visit us once in 3/4 months from India till immigration visa is received.
As i undersatnd, option with us is to go on applying for extension to my mother's visitors visa every six months. But as Masood Bhai mentioned in one of the postings, extension becomes difficult after third extention. However with the above time schedule, we may need 5/6 extentions before immigration visa is received by my parents.
What is the best course of action for me under the above circumstances? If my mother has to go back to India when she doesn't get extention beyond 3rd extention , and she applies again for a visitor's visa in Delhi, will they refuse because she applied for 3 extensions for the previous visitor's visa? Will the fact that my parents immigration visa application will be pending with Delhi CHC affect the issue of visitors visa once gain to my mother?
Best option: keep applying for extension until they refuse.
- your mum goes back and waits for PR visa
- if she applies for visitor's visa again it won't affect the sponsorship but less likely that Delhi will issue visitor's visa
